Al Shabaab militants attacked a military base in Puntland’s Bari region engaging in heavy gunfire. The jihadists attacked the militant base at the daybreak as is their mode of operation.
Al Shabaab has since taken responsibility for the early morning attack that killed at least two soldiers and injuring several others. Puntland officials maintain that while the onslaught is still ongoing, at least a dozen al Shabaab militants have been killed and the remaining fighters have been significantly been weakened.
Al Shabaab in Puntland has been rather docile as compared to those encampments located in the central and south of Somalia. The attack comes as the US steps up its airstrikes against the al-Qaeda affiliate in the vicinity of its headquarters in Jilib.
